Port Vale Couldn’t Compete With Hull

Bill Bratt, chairman of Port Vale has said that both Sam Collins and Billy Paynter will ‘earn a lot more’ at Championship outfit Hull. Both players have joined The Tigers on loan with a view to permanent moves in the January transfer window. Collins will command a fee of £65 000 and Paynter will cost £125 00.

Bratt says that although the pair moved to the KC Stadium for footballing reasons they will also earn more money at Hull and hard up Vale would not have been able to compete with the wages being offered.

He said: ‘Sam and Billy are ambitious lads and now have a great chance to prove themselves at a higher level. Good luck to them, they have been great servants to Port Vale and will now earn a lot more money at Hull.’
